Building Your Darts Influencer Platform
The core of your darts influencer platform business is the platform itself. This could be a website, a mobile app, or even a dedicated section within an existing sports platform. Key features should include:
- Influencer Profiles: Detailed profiles showcasing their stats, content, audience demographics, and engagement rates.
- Campaign Management Tools: Tools for brands to create and manage influencer marketing campaigns.
- Analytics Dashboard: Comprehensive analytics to track campaign performance and influencer ROI.
- Communication Features: Integrated communication tools for brands and influencers to connect and collaborate.
- Payment Processing: Secure and reliable payment processing for influencer payouts.
Consider also incorporating features that foster community engagement, such as forums, live streams, and interactive Q&A sessions with influencers.
Investing in a user-friendly and feature-rich platform is essential for attracting both influencers and brands to your darts influencer platform business. Consider the user experience from both sides and iterate based on feedback.

Monetization Strategies for Your Darts Influencer Platform
Beyond brand partnerships, explore other monetization strategies for your darts influencer platform business:
- Subscription Fees: Charge brands a subscription fee for access to the platform and its features.
- Commission on Campaigns: Take a commission on all influencer marketing campaigns executed through the platform.
- Premium Services: Offer premium services such as campaign strategy consulting, content creation, and influencer management.
- Data and Analytics Reports: Sell access to anonymized data and analytics reports to brands and researchers.
- Affiliate Marketing: Partner with darts equipment retailers and earn a commission on sales generated through influencer promotions.
Diversifying your revenue streams will make your platform more resilient and sustainable in the long run. Regularly evaluate your monetization strategies and adapt them to the evolving needs of the darts market. Remember to remain transparent with both influencers and brands about your pricing and commission structures.

Legal and Ethical Considerations
When operating a darts influencer platform business, it’s important to adhere to all relevant legal and ethical guidelines. This includes:
- Transparency: Ensure that influencers clearly disclose sponsored content and brand partnerships.
- Truthfulness: Require influencers to provide accurate and truthful information about products and services.
- Compliance: Comply with all applicable advertising regulations and consumer protection laws.
- Data Privacy: Protect the privacy of users and comply with all relevant data privacy laws.
- Fairness: Treat all influencers and brands fairly and equitably.
Establish clear guidelines for influencers and brands to follow, and enforce these guidelines consistently. By adhering to high ethical standards, you can build trust and credibility with your community.
